What Drip Tea Bag do you recommend?

Drip Tea Bag Hojicha (5g x 6 bags)

How do you enjoy it?

I drink it in my favourite mug after finishing lunch. Simply smelling the wonderful, mild aroma that wafts into the air the moment I pour on the hot water soothes and relaxes me. And, it has a great taste that is every bit as good as hojicha prepared in a kyusu teapot. It leaves my mouth feeling refreshed, so I am ready to dive back into work in the afternoon. I make myself a second mug using the same tea leaves to keep me going while doing desk work.

What do you recommend pairing it with?

A good choice is dorayaki—two small sponge-cake patties wrapped around a filling of sweet bean paste. I think this tea goes particularly well with dorayaki, which has a heavenly smelling malty dough baked a light brown colour. As I breathe in the aromas given off by the dorayaki and hojicha, they mingled and balance beautifully. I think Ippodo’s hojicha is versatile enough to complement any sweet bean paste.
